Abandoned Mafia Heiress Rises as a Billionaire Chapter 1

"You're free to go."

The guard's cold voice echoed through the cold, gray walls as he unlocked my cell. The metal door opened, and I stepped into the blinding light outside.

Finally! I was released from the cage that kept me trapped for two long years. I still remember how I took the fall for my stepbrother, Luca Bianchi and served two years in this brutal prison.

Meanwhile, he was busy building and expanding his empire and playing the dutiful family man.

"I had to save my family's reputation," I whispered under my breath.

After giving it a long thought, the first thing I did after my release was to call home. I was eager to surprise them as I imagined their relief, and their happiness to hear from me again, but the response was…silence.

"Uncle, I'm out."

Before I could say more, the line went dead. Richard, my paternal uncle, my father's only brother had hung up on me. It was so unlikely of him.

My throat tightened and my stomach churned. The next moment I hailed a cab and headed straight for home. My heart was accelerating at the highest speed as I hoped that everything would be alright there.

When I reached there, I heard the whispering of voices. All of them were familiar yet cold, echoing through the front door.

My hand froze on the handle as I recognized Celestia—Luca’s wife—and my stepmother, Gracia's voice.

"Why is she returning home?" Celestia’s voice was cold, almost panicked. “Of all days, she had to get out today. I had something important to deal with."

Within seconds, my stepmother, Gracia's reply came. “It’s for the best. Don't worry, she won't be here for long. Now with records like her, she’ll even struggle to find a job. Nobody is going to accept her as a Mafia princess."

When I heard their icy words, it felt like a knife pierced my heart. My mother, who had died protecting this family’s legacy, had been replaced by a woman who was treating me as nothing more than a hindrance.

And my father… he would have killed Gracia if he would have been alive.

Meanwhile, Celestia’s voice turned more aggressive.“I’m not living with an ex-con. Let her fight for herself—she’s not my family."

My blood ran cold. The people who I thought would welcome me back were already conspiring to get rid of me.

But just as I stepped towards the door, shaken, I felt the sharp press of a gun barrel against my spine. As I turned back, I only saw one of Luca’s guards, his gaze cold and predatory.

“Miss,” he said, forcing a smirk, "You aren't allowed inside."

Before I could comprehend his words, he shoved me back from the door, the metal of the gun shining under the dim light.

Due to the sudden commotion, Gracia opened the door. Her eyes widened as she found me on the ground. Her face settled into an expression of forced surprise.

“Victoria!” She gave me a long look. Her gaze roamed over my worn clothes and tired face. “You’re… home? My poor girl, prison must’ve been tough on you.”

There was a hint of mockery in her wrinkled eyes.

“Yeah, but I managed,” I replied, trying to keep my voice steady and stood up.

Without delay, I stepped inside, but before I could take another step, Celestia rushed forward with a bottle of disinfectant spray.

Her lip curled in distaste. Without hesitation, she emptied half the bottle over me, drenching me from head to toe.

“Don’t take it personally, Victoria,” she mumbled. “Just making sure you’re not bringing any bad luck with you.”

I clenched my fists, the sting of humiliation burning through me, but I kept silent. I knew my place there was shaky and fragile, and for now, I didn’t want to fight. I just wanted to be home.

Without another word, I turned toward my room. As I opened the door, I froze.

Boxes and bags filled the space. The clutter was filling every corner. My belongings were nowhere to be seen.

I turned to Gracia, who was standing in the hallway, her gaze averted. “Mom, what happened to my room?”

She bit her lower lip as she avoided my eyes. “Well… you were gone for so long, and Celestia needed the space. We had to use your room for storage.”

“And my things?” I was blanked. I opened my mouth twice but no words came out. Even though I already dreaded the answer, still I forced myself to ask,

She looked away. “We got rid of them.”

Every word hit me like a slap, but it was my uncle, Richard, who twisted the knife deeper.

From the sofa, he barely glanced at me. “Victoria, Celestia's five months pregnant. She needs a clean, open space for the baby. You didn’t need those things anymore.”

I stood there. It wouldn't be a lie if I said that I was feeling like a stranger in the home where I’d once dreamed of returning to. I was abandoned by the people I’d sacrificed everything for.

My heart sank further as I looked around. My chest tightened. But just then, my phone buzzed in my pocket. With an unconscious mind, I pulled it out and saw a new message.

“Thank you for protecting my daughter.”

At that moment, my mind went back to the prison. I remembered the girl I’d protected there. The one who was targeted by other inmates simply because of her family’s wealth and status

Despite the bruises and injuries I'd endured, I’d kept her safe. Later on, I got to know that she was the daughter of the most influential and powerful business tycoon. His empire was stretched deep into the underworld.

Another message buzz brought me back to the present moment. I blinked twice, rereading the words as it was a bank notification.

"A hundred million dollars has been credited to your account."
